#c7e9c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7e9c5 is composed of 78% red, 91.4%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 116.7 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 84.3%. #c7e9c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8fd38b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#c7e9c5 color description : Light grayish lime green.
#c7e9c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7e9c5 has RGB values of R:199, G:233,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13101509.
